Water Softener Service in Raleigh, NC
Water softener service involves maintaining, repairing, or replacing systems designed to reduce mineral buildup caused by hard water. These services typically cover tasks such as inspecting the unit for issues, cleaning or replacing resin beads, checking salt levels, and ensuring the system operates efficiently. Homeowners often request water softener services when experiencing problems like limescale buildup on fixtures, reduced water flow, or when the system is not regenerating properly, which can affect the longevity of plumbing and appliances.
Before requesting water softener service, property owners usually want to understand the age and condition of their existing system, as well as any specific symptoms or issues they’ve noticed. It’s also helpful to know the type of water softener installed and whether any recent repairs or maintenance have been performed. This information can assist in determining the most appropriate service to restore optimal performance and extend the lifespan of the water softening system.

Water Softener Service Questions
How often should water softener service be performed? Regular maintenance typically involves annual inspections and filter regeneration to ensure optimal performance and water quality.
What are common signs that a water softener needs service? Signs include reduced softening effectiveness, increased mineral buildup, or a noticeable change in water taste or appearance.
What does water softener service include? Service generally involves cleaning resin tanks, checking salt levels, and testing water hardness to maintain proper operation.
Why is professional water softener service important? Professional service helps prevent system failures, extends equipment lifespan, and ensures consistent water quality throughout the property.
